A local childcare provider in Wigton seeks a Residential Childcare Support Worker to join their team. The ideal candidate will support young boys in daily routines, including hygiene and meals, and attend medical appointments. This role requires flexibility for shift and sleep-in duties.
Qualifications include a Residential Childcare Diploma or NVQ Level 3, and experience in youth work is a plus.
Benefits include a sleep-in allowance and comprehensive training programs.
